Mounting tweeters

I ordered CDT Audio CL-61 components and i'm wondering where to mount the tweeters on a 4th gen... where is the best spot for the most direct way at the driver?

One friend of mine says to flush mount it up on the dash so the sound is bounced off the windshield... another one says to try to aim it from the A Pillar, but that may be difficult or very dependant on the mounts that come with the speakers...

i can't make up my mind... please post pics if you have em
